About Bo Pan
Bo Pan is a scholar working on Surgery, Molecular Biology, Genetics, Pulmonary and Respiratory Medicine and Genetics, having authored 35 papers that have together received 836 indexed citations. Recurring topics across this work include Reconstructive Facial Surgery Techniques (14 papers), Congenital Ear and Nasal Anomalies (3 papers), Head and Neck Anomalies (3 papers), Tracheal and airway disorders (2 papers), Reconstructive Surgery and Microvascular Techniques (2 papers), Orthopedic Surgery and Rehabilitation (1 paper), Medical and Biological Sciences (1 paper) and Ferroptosis and cancer prognosis (1 paper). The work is most often cited by research in General Dentistry (33 citations), Modeling and Simulation (75 citations), Infectious Diseases (278 citations), Neurology (109 citations) and Obstetrics and Gynecology (47 citations). Bo Pan has collaborated with scholars based in China, Israel and Malaysia. Frequent co-authors include Pengfei Sun, Xiaosheng Lu, Chao Xu, Yang Yang, Gaofeng Li, Xin Huang, Zhong Qian, Lin Lin, Nuo Si and Fang Luan. Their work appears in journals such as Journal of Craniofacial Surgery, Journal of Plastic Reconstructive & Aesthetic Surgery, Scientific Reports, International Journal of Pediatric Otorhinolaryngology and Frontiers in Plant Science.
